Eris, a dwarf planet located in the scattered disc region of the solar system, is primarily composed of a mixture of rock and ice. Its surface is believed to be covered in a layer of frozen methane, nitrogen, and possibly other ices, giving it a bright, reflective appearance. The exact composition is still not fully understood due to its distance from Earth, but it is thought to resemble Pluto in terms of its icy and rocky materials.
